Transaction

8b3abfbb509454b60f495a26cbdaa49731830d7d0d8100c8de407ee434e66a43
623,545 confirmations
Timestamp
1408809213
Block317,131
Fee20,000 sats
Fee rate45.9 sats/vB
view on mempool.space

Inputs & Outputs